Early Morning Vehicle Break-Ins at Georgia Hotel Prompt Investigation
Multiple vehicle break-ins occurred early Monday morning at the Country Inn & Suites in Macon, Georgia, with six cars having their windows smashed. Victims, including travelers and local government employees, reported significant losses such as cash, personal electronics, and gifts. The crimes took place around 4:30 a.m., with the sheriff's office receiving the first call at 4:48 a.m. Despite being parked in visible, well-lit areas near the hotel lobby, victims expressed frustration over the lack of response from hotel staff upon discovering the damage. The Bibb County Sheriff's Office is actively investigating the incident and reviewing hotel security footage to identify the responsible parties. Victims are concerned that initial law enforcement responses were minimal, but the investigation continues to explore all leads.
